Output 4290c68dc4e8236803206e8e92f1ba0e96bf4d260d1dad0846ab2b373a0fc7e0:43

value
75659
script pubkey
OP_0 OP_PUSHBYTES_20 09c1d41161011f76e90eeb31db55d663206e2172
address
bc1qp8qagytpqy0hd6gwavcak4wkvvsxugtjrg6akh
transaction
4290c68dc4e8236803206e8e92f1ba0e96bf4d260d1dad0846ab2b373a0fc7e0
confirmations
1135
spent
true